At Satellite and Terrestrial Works Ltd, we take health and safety seriously. It’s a normal part of how we run the business and plan our work, not something separate.

We aim to carry out all of our work safely, whether that’s a straightforward job or a more complex installation.

How we work

In day-to-day terms, we:

  • Use equipment and tools that are suitable for the job and kept in good condition
  • Plan our work properly, including Starlink installations, so risks are reduced as much as possible
  • Carry out risk assessments where needed, especially when working at height
  • Handle and move materials safely
  • Make sure the team has the right information, training and support to do the job properly
  • Keep communication clear on site so everyone knows what’s going on

Our team

Everyone working for us is expected to take a common-sense approach to safety. This includes:

  • Following safe working methods
  • Using the correct PPE
  • Speaking up if something doesn’t look right
  • Reporting hazards or issues so they can be dealt with

Standards

We work to recognised industry standards and hold:

  • SMAS (SSIP) accreditation
  • ISO 45001 certification

These reflect how we manage health and safety across the business.

Responsibility

Overall responsibility sits with the Director, who makes sure this approach is followed and reviewed as the business develops.
